Types of Bodily Harm Cases and Their Distinct Challenges
Personal injury cases include a wide range of incidents, each creating different challenges for victims and their legal representatives. Car accidents, for instance, often involve complex insurance claims and liability disputes, making it essential to collect evidence swiftly. Medical malpractice cases demand extensive knowledge of healthcare standards and necessitate expert testimony, adding layers of complexity.
Product liability cases involving products can be quite difficult, as they require proving that a product was faulty and caused harm, often involving large corporations with substantial financial backing. Slip and fall cases copyright on proving carelessness, which can be difficult if the property owner disputes responsibility.
Workplace harm may involve workers' compensation claims, where the injured employee must comply with specific regulations. Every form of case requires tailored methods to effectively defend the victim, emphasizing the significance of understanding these unique challenges to achieve just compensation.

Methods to Boost Your Earnings Following an Accident
Improving monetary recovery following an accident requires strategic planning and detailed documentation. Individuals should begin by collecting all relevant evidence, including photographs of the location, witness recollections, and medical documentation. This documentation acts as paramount backing for any claims filed with insurance companies.
Consulting with a compassionate personal injury representative is essential; they can guide you through legal complexities and advocate for the injured individual. Additionally, it's paramount to keep a detailed account of all accident-related expenditures, such as medical bills, unpaid earnings, and recovery expenditures.
Victims should also avoid providing early comments to insurance adjusters, as these can compromise their claims. Finally, knowing the statute of limitations for filing claims ensures prompt action, preserving the right to seek compensation. By employing these strategies, victims can improve their chances of receiving fair compensation for their damages and losses.
Frequently Posed Questions
What Price Does a Bodily Harm Attorney Normally Cost?
Personal injury lawyers typically charge between 25% to 40% of the awarded settlement as contingent fees. This means clients only pay if they win their case, rendering attorney services more accessible for those in need.
What Need to I Bring Along to My First Visit?
At the opening appointment, parties should gather relevant documents such as accident reports, medical records, insurance information, and any correspondence related to the incident. This information helps the lawyer analyze the case effectively.
What is the average duration of a personal injury lawsuit?
A bodily injury lawsuit usually takes anywhere from a few months to several years to settle, depending on factors like matter difficulty, negotiation processes, and court schedules, impacting the overall timeline considerably.
